### Account Recovery — Catalogue Import (Lintwood)

Quick one for review: when the Lintwood catalogue import wipes a patron's session table, the recovery flow re-seeds accounts from the nightly snapshot. Check that the importer skips locked accounts — last time it didn't. To rerun recovery against staging you'll need the vault passphrase, which is appended just below.

recovery phrase for yafof-tajof: julmir-kelax-julvan-holath-belvan-holir-ralael-ralvan-ralath-julvan-silmir-istmir-kaswyn-ulamir

Quarterly Planning Note — Franchise Agreement

For the incoming director: the Pellam Grove franchise agreement renews next quarter under revised royalty terms. Tollan Foods has accepted the updated territory map but contests the marketing levy. Legal expects resolution before renewal signing. Operational handover of the two pilot sites proceeds regardless. Familiarize yourself with the file before the board review. The confidential note below sets out the wider plan.

internal memo for fajog-yagaf: Gross margin on Ulaael came in at 20 percent against a plan of 10 percent. Only 9 of the 80 pilot accounts renewed Ulaael, so a churn review is set for July 1.

Night shift — the first-aid room on the ground floor of the Renholt Annexe got restocked today, so the old supply list taped to the cabinet is out of date. Bin it. New kit includes a defib trainer, so don't panic if you see it. The door now auto-locks after 20:00 as part of the Quillbrook security rollout. If anyone needs access overnight, use the code below.

staff pass of kawip-hawef = bdg-QLP-2

# Environments — Bramblecourt Orders Service

Three tiers: dev, staging, prod. Prod runs two read replicas behind the query router; staging runs one. The replica lag alarm fired twice this week on prod-east — both times during the bulk export window, lag peaked near 40s against a 15s threshold. Proposal for the sync: widen the window or throttle exports. Current replica and alarm settings on prod-east are shown here.

service settings:
[quenath]
host = quenath.zemvarcorp.corp
user = quenath_svc
database = quenath_prod